Analog to Digital Converters - ADC 14-bit, 125Msps, 1.8V Low-Power Dual ADC, Parallel Outputs
2-Channel Dual ADC Pipelined 125Msps 14-bit Parallel 64-Pin QFN EP Tube
ADC, Proprietary Method, 14-Bit, 1 Func, 2 Channel, Parallel, Word Access, CMOS, PQCC64
ADC, DUAL, 14BIT, 125MSPS, 64QFN; Resolution (Bits):14bit; Sampling Rate:125MSPS; Supply Voltage Range - Analogue:1.7V to 1.9V; Supply Current:105.2mA; Digital IC Case Style:QFN; No. of Pins:64; Operating Temperature Range:0°C to 70°C; SVHC:No SVHC (19-Dec-2011); Data Interface:Parallel, Serial; Input Channel Type:Differential, Single Ended; No. of Channels:2
